Preparation
- Begin by placing the chicken breasts in your slow cooker.
- Sprinkle the ranch seasoning mix evenly over the chicken.
- Layer the cream cheese on top of the chicken.
- Cover the slow cooker and set it to cook on low for 6-8 hours or on high for 3-4 hours.
- Once cooked, use two forks to shred the chicken and mix it with the cream cheese and seasoning until thoroughly combined.
- Stir in the shredded cheddar cheese along with the crumbled bacon.
- Serve your Crack Chicken on a toasted sandwich bun or simply on its own, garnished with green onions.
Notes
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 4 days. To reheat, warm it on the stovetop or microwave until hot. Freeze before adding cheese and bacon for best results.
